Why bay windows need specialist secondary glazing

A standard secondary glazing panel is designed for a flat, rectangular window. A Victorian or Edwardian bay is different. It may include:

  • Three or five separate window sections
  • Angled returns forming a canted bay
  • A curved or bow-shaped elevation
  • Sash, casement or fixed lights
  • Decorative glazing bars or leaded lights
  • Uneven reveals and non-standard corner details
  • Limited space for opening and cleaning the secondary panels

The secondary frame must follow the geometry of the existing bay. This requires precise measurements of every angle, width, height and reveal depth. For a canted bay, the panels may be individually fabricated and joined at the corners. For a bow bay, a series of faceted sections can approximate the curve while maintaining a continuous acoustic and thermal seal.

The objective is not simply to cover the window. It is to create a properly sealed internal layer that works with the original glazing.

Bay window secondary glazing options

The right configuration depends on how your original windows operate and how much access you need.

Bay configurationCommon secondary glazing approachBest suited to
Three-panel canted bayIndividually measured angled panels with joined cornersMany Victorian and Edwardian terraces
Five-panel bayMultiple sections with carefully coordinated corner detailsLarger period properties and wider projections
Curved or bow bayNarrow faceted panels following the curveVictorian bow windows and rounded elevations
Sash bayVertical sliding secondary panels or discreet fixed sectionsBays retaining usable original sash windows
Casement bayHinged, fixed or removable panelsEdwardian bays with side-hung or top-hung casements
Fixed bayFixed secondary frames where ventilation is not requiredInfrequently opened rooms or sealed acoustic installations

Sliding, hinged or fixed panels?

  • Choose vertical sliding panels if you need to continue opening your sash windows for ventilation and cleaning.
  • Choose hinged panels if your bay contains casements and you need regular access to the original handles.
  • Choose fixed panels if maximum simplicity and acoustic sealing are more important than frequent access. Fixed sections may be suitable for parts of the bay that are rarely opened.

A specialist survey should check that handles, catches, shutters, curtains and blinds will continue to operate after installation.

How much noise reduction can you expect?

Acoustic performance is measured in decibels, or dB. The decibel scale is logarithmic, so a small numerical change can represent a significant change in perceived sound. With a suitable specification, acoustic secondary glazing can reduce noise by up to 54dB. The result depends on the complete window assembly, not only the glass. The main performance factors are:

  1. Air gap. A larger gap between the original window and secondary panel creates a more effective sound buffer. An air gap of approximately 100–150mm is often desirable where the reveal allows it.
  2. Acoustic laminated glass. The laminated interlayer helps dampen sound vibration. A typical high-performance specification may use 10.8mm acoustic laminated glass.
  3. Airtight seals. Sound will exploit small gaps. Frame joints, opening sections and perimeter seals must be properly fitted.
  4. The original window. Loose sashes, damaged putty, open vents and gaps around the primary frame can reduce the benefit of the new internal glazing.
  5. Other transmission paths. Noise may also travel through walls, roofs, doors, chimneys and ventilation openings. Secondary glazing is highly effective at the window, but it cannot eliminate sound entering elsewhere.

Choose acoustic secondary glazing if your bay faces buses, traffic, railway lines, pubs, construction activity or a flight path. A measured reduction of 54dB should be treated as an upper performance claim, not a guaranteed result in every room. A survey allows the specification to be matched to the type and frequency of noise affecting your home.

Thermal performance and energy costs

Bay windows can feel cold because they have a large glazed area, exposed angles and often older single-glazed panes. Cold surfaces may also contribute to draughts and surface condensation. Secondary glazing creates an additional insulating layer inside the original window. In the right conditions, it can cut heat loss through the window by up to 64%. The thermal benefit depends on:

  • The original glass and frame condition
  • The secondary glass specification
  • The width and continuity of the air gap
  • Perimeter seals
  • The presence of draughts around the primary frame
  • How the room is heated and ventilated

Choose thermal secondary glazing if your priority is reducing cold downdraughts, improving room comfort and retaining original windows that cannot be replaced. Listed buildings and conservation areas

Replacing original bay windows with modern double glazing can be difficult where a property is listed or located in a conservation area. The external appearance, historic glass, frame proportions and architectural details may need to be preserved. Secondary glazing is often a viable alternative because it is:

  • Installed on the inside of the existing window
  • Reversible
  • Invisible or minimally visible from outside
  • Compatible with original sash and casement windows
  • Less disruptive to historic fabric than window replacement

However, do not assume that consent is unnecessary. Listed Building Consent may be required where work affects the character of a listed building, even if the proposed installation is reversible. Before ordering, contact your local planning or conservation officer. Provide:

  • Photographs of the existing bay
  • The proposed frame and glass specification
  • Details of how the system will be fixed
  • Confirmation that the installation is internal and reversible
  • Section drawings if requested

Which solution is right for your bay?

Choose secondary glazing if:

  • You want to retain original Victorian or Edwardian windows.
  • Your property is listed or in a conservation area.
  • External appearance must remain unchanged.
  • Noise is entering through a large bay elevation.
  • You want a reversible improvement.
  • Your existing windows are repairable but thermally or acoustically weak.

Consider repairing the original windows first if:

  • Sashes are loose or badly draughty.
  • Putty, timber or catches are damaged.
  • There are large gaps around the primary frame.
  • Condensation is caused by poor ventilation rather than glazing alone.

Consider replacement glazing only if:

  • The original windows are beyond practical repair.
  • Planning and heritage restrictions permit replacement.
  • You accept changes to the external appearance.
  • You have compared whole-life cost, performance and architectural impact.

For many London period homes, secondary glazing provides the most balanced route: improved comfort without sacrificing the bay's original character.

What happens during a specialist survey?

A proper bay window survey should record more than the overall width and height. The surveyor should inspect:

  • Every bay angle and corner
  • The depth of each reveal
  • Sash or casement operation
  • Existing handles, catches and shutters
  • Ventilation requirements
  • Curtain and blind clearances
  • Frame condition and draught paths
  • Access for installation and future cleaning

The secondary frames are then custom-fabricated to the measured dimensions. Options may include vertical sliding, hinged, fixed or removable sections, with colour matching available for heritage interiors.
